How to prepare for phase 1

You should:

  • review your tenant screening process – ensure it complies with non-discrimination rules
  • focus only on affordability, references, and credit history when assessing applications
  • remove any outdated policies that might unintentionally exclude certain groups
  • if you are using an agent, ensure they are following the guidance on your behalf
  • landlords and agents will have to publish the asking rent and not accept offers made above this rate
  • familiarise yourself with the new possession grounds – understand when and how you can lawfully regain possession
  • keep clear records if you plan to sell, refurbish, or move into a property to support any future possession claims
  • improve tenant communication
  • create a fair and transparent pet policy, balancing tenant need, property upkeep and property suitability
  • set up a rent review calendar - plan rent adjustments in a structured way
  • ensure rent increases are based on market conditions to avoid disputes
  • keep clear records of rent changes and justifications
  • do your research - get to know your local market
